  • This study was to develop the flood analysis module (FAM) for implementation of a web-based real-time agricultural flood management system. The FAM was developed to apply for an individual watershed, including agricultural reservoir. This module calculates the flood inflow hydrograph to the reservoir using effective rainfall by NRCS-CN method and unit hydrograph calculated by Clark, SCS, and Nakayasu synthetic unit hydrograph methods, and then perform the reservoir routing by modified Puls method. It was programmed to consider the automatic reservoir operation method (AutoROM) based on flood control water level of reservoir. For a $15.7km^2$ Gyeryong watershed including $472{\times}10^4m^3$ agricultural reservoir, rainfall loss, rainfall excess, peak inflow, total inflow, maximum discharge, and maximum water level for each duration time were compared between the FAM and HEC-HMS (applied SCS and Clark unit hydrograph methods). The FAM results showed entirely consistent for all components with simulated results by HEC-HMS. It means that the applied methods to the FAM were implemented properly.

  • The Snyder's Unit Hydrograph Method is applied to simulate the November 1985 Flood of the Cheat River Basin, which is located in the North-East region of West Virginia in United States. The entire basin is divided into many subareas according to the hydrologic and geologic characteristics. The overland flows are computed on each subarea and combined together along the streams. The flows are also routed by the Normal Depth Storage and Outflow Method in Modified Pulse option. The several structural flood control alternatives are examined. The study shows the OPTION III which has the three moderately sized dam is ultimately suitable to control the flood. The HEC-1 computer model is used to analyze the flood.

  • Recently, the flood damages including losses of human lifes and property have been rapidly increased according to extreme floods. And we know that the flood control project is needed for diminishing flood damages. However, we have had the lacks in a reasonable methodology for the economic analysis of food control project. This study aims to improve the existing economic analysis method for flood control project. So, first of all, we understand the problems of existing economic analysis and investigate the methodologies of foreign countries. Based on that, the Multi-Dimensional Flood Damage Analysis(MD-FDA) is developed in this study. The survey of properties on the floodplain is conducted, then the damage rate obtained by evaluating the monetary values of surveyed property is applied, and the expected flood damage is calculated. Also by considering damage area in the floodplain as well as spatial distribution of inundated depth using GIS, the flood damages are evaluated more accurately than existing method. From the study, we know that the MD-FDA can improve the problems of existing method and evaluate the reasonable flood damages by using updated nation리 statistics.

  • EAP, which is operated on the frame of Risk Alarm 4-stage of National Risk Management Guideline, is a critical method in order to promptly respond to disasters. Korea Flood Control Office issues major and moderate flood alarm at each river station by respectively 50% and 70% of design flood discharge in terms of watermark or sea level, however, the criteria deciding major and moderate floods are vague for field managers to control the disaster situations. On the other hand, Japan and USA use river water level as a main criterion in order to classify the stage of flood disaster, which is higher design flood level than Korea. Thus, the authors analyzed domestic and oversea EAP guidelines and suggested improved criteria showing easy display method and raising the criteria of flood level for reflecting more effective action plans through testing a simulation training on the test-bed.

  • This study applied the fuzzy logic control for the construction of the reservoir operation model which can consider uncertainty of the predicted inflow in determining reservoir release during flood period. The control rule is usually constructed based on the opinion of experts which is a general technique. To improve the drawback of general technique, this study constructed the Fuzzy-Tabu search model automatically established by the fuzzy rule using Tabu search which is a global optimization technique. As the results, the peak release is decreased and the flood control efficiency is improved. The total release is also decreased and this represents the benefit in water use. Consequently, it is confirmed that the effect of flood control can be increased through the constructed model. It also shows that the available water resources after the flood is more increased. So, the proposed Fuzzy-Tabu search model could be better than the actual reservoir operation methodology in the aspect of water use.

  • Reallocation procedure of multipurpose reservoir storage capacity between flood control and conservation is presented as an alternative to secure more water resources. Storage reallocation is an adaptive management mechanism for converting existing normal pool level of reservoirs to more beneficial uses without requirement for physical alteration. This study is intended to develop a reservoir storage reallocation methodology that allows increased water supply storage without minimizing adverse impacts on flood control. The methodology consists of flood control reservoir simulation for inflows with various return periods, flow routing from reservoir to a potential damage site, analyzing river carrying capacity, and reservoir yields estimation for reallocated storages. For the flood control model, a simulation model called Rigid ROM(Reservoir Operation Method) and HEC-5 are used. The approach is illustrated by applying it to two reservoirs system in Geum River basin. Especially with and without new project conditions are considered to analyze trade-offs between competing objectives.
